What Is an Angle Grinder and How Is It Used in Woodworking?
An angle grinder is a versatile power tool commonly used in various applications, including woodworking, metalworking, and construction. It is equipped with a rotating abrasive disc that can cut, grind, or polish materials. In woodworking, an angle grinder is particularly useful for shaping wood, removing excess material, and finishing surfaces.
According to the American National Standards Institute (ANSI), angle grinders are classified as hand-held power tools designed to grind, cut, or polish various materials based on the attachment used (ANSI B7.1). Their adaptability makes them valuable in both professional and DIY woodworking projects.
Key aspects of an angle grinder include its speed, power source (cordless or corded), and the variety of attachments available. The RPM (revolutions per minute) can range significantly, with most models operating between 5,000 to 12,000 RPM, allowing for different levels of cutting and grinding precision. The choice of disc—such as flap discs, cutting wheels, or sanding discs—will also affect the tool’s performance in woodworking tasks.
This tool impacts woodworking projects by providing a quick and efficient means to achieve smooth finishes and precise cuts. For instance, when using a flap disc, woodworkers can remove rough edges and prepare surfaces for staining or sealing. Additionally, the ability to cut through thicker materials, such as hardwoods, makes angle grinders essential for complex woodworking tasks that require detailed shaping and finishing.

Best practices when using an angle grinder for woodworking include wearing appropriate safety gear, such as goggles and gloves, to protect against flying debris. Additionally, selecting the right disc for the specific task is crucial; for instance, using a sanding disc for finishing rather than a cutting wheel can prevent damage to the wood. Regular maintenance of the tool, including checking for wear and tear, will also ensure optimal performance and safety.
What Features Are Essential for the Best Angle Grinder in Woodworking?
The essential features for the best angle grinder in woodworking include:
- Variable Speed Control: This feature allows users to adjust the RPM of the grinder, which is crucial for different types of woodworking tasks. Lower speeds are ideal for polishing and sanding, while higher speeds are better for cutting and grinding harder materials.
- Power and Amperage: A higher amperage rating typically indicates a more powerful motor, enabling the grinder to handle tougher jobs without bogging down. For woodworking, a motor in the range of 7 to 10 amps is generally sufficient, providing a good balance of power and control.
- Comfortable Grip and Weight: An ergonomic design with a comfortable grip reduces user fatigue during extended use. A lightweight angle grinder is easier to maneuver, which is especially important in detailed woodworking tasks.
- Disc Size Compatibility: The best angle grinders should be compatible with a variety of disc sizes, typically ranging from 4.5 to 7 inches. This versatility allows users to choose the right disc for specific woodworking applications, such as cutting, grinding, or sanding.
- Safety Features: Important safety features include a protective guard, which shields users from debris, and a safety switch that prevents accidental starts. Additionally, anti-vibration technology can enhance user comfort and control, making woodworking safer and more efficient.
- Dust Protection: Woodworking generates a significant amount of dust, so an angle grinder with good dust-sealing mechanisms can prolong the tool’s lifespan. Features like dust guards or vacuum attachments help keep the work area clean and the tool functioning optimally.
- Durability and Build Quality: A robust construction with high-quality materials ensures that the angle grinder can withstand the rigors of woodworking tasks. Look for grinders with metal housings and heavy-duty components for enhanced durability and longevity.
How Do Power and RPM Affect Angle Grinder Performance?
Power and RPM are critical factors that influence the performance of angle grinders, especially when selecting the best angle grinder for woodworking.
- Power (Wattage): The wattage of an angle grinder indicates its power output, which directly affects its ability to cut through various materials.
- RPM (Revolutions Per Minute): RPM measures how many times the grinder’s disc rotates in a minute, impacting the speed and efficiency of cutting or sanding tasks.
- Torque: Torque is the rotational force produced by the grinder, which is essential for maintaining performance under load.
- Disc Diameter: The size of the grinding or cutting disc can affect both the power needed and the RPM required for effective operation.
Power (Wattage): Higher wattage typically provides more power, enabling the angle grinder to handle tougher materials and more demanding tasks without stalling. For woodworking, a grinder with at least 800 watts is recommended to ensure smooth operation and the ability to tackle hardwoods and dense materials effectively.
RPM (Revolutions Per Minute): The RPM rating dictates how quickly the grinder’s disc spins, which is crucial for achieving clean cuts and finishes. For woodworking, a higher RPM is beneficial as it allows for faster material removal, although it’s important to match the speed with the type of wood and the cutting disc being used to avoid burn marks or splintering.
Torque: The torque provided by an angle grinder helps maintain consistent cutting performance, especially when applying pressure during use. Grinders with higher torque are less likely to bog down when cutting through dense wood, making them more efficient for woodworking projects.
Disc Diameter: The diameter of the disc affects both the cutting depth and the power requirements of the angle grinder. For woodworking, discs between 4.5 to 5 inches are commonly used, offering a good balance of precision and power, while larger discs may require more RPM to achieve effective results without causing damage to the material.
What Size Angle Grinder Is Most Suitable for Woodworking Projects?
The most suitable angle grinder sizes for woodworking projects generally range from 4.5 to 7 inches, depending on the specific tasks and materials involved.
- 4.5-Inch Angle Grinder: This size is ideal for smaller, detailed woodworking tasks such as sanding, shaping, and finishing. Its lightweight design allows for greater maneuverability and control, making it perfect for intricate work on smaller projects or tight spaces.
- 5-Inch Angle Grinder: Offering a balance between power and size, a 5-inch angle grinder is versatile for both detailed work and more substantial tasks. It’s suitable for sanding larger surfaces and can handle a variety of attachments, making it a great choice for hobbyists and professionals alike.
- 6-Inch Angle Grinder: This grinder size provides additional power and surface area, making it suitable for larger woodworking projects that require more aggressive material removal. It is effective for tasks like grinding, cutting, and shaping larger pieces of wood while still maintaining a reasonable level of control.
- 7-Inch Angle Grinder: Typically used for heavy-duty woodworking tasks, a 7-inch angle grinder can tackle tougher materials and larger surfaces efficiently. While it offers increased power, it may be less maneuverable for delicate work, making it better suited for more robust applications such as removing large amounts of material or working on big projects.

What Safety Considerations Should Be Made When Using Angle Grinders for Woodworking?
When using angle grinders for woodworking, several safety considerations must be taken into account to ensure safe operation and prevent accidents.
- Personal Protective Equipment (PPE): Always wear appropriate PPE, including safety goggles, dust masks, and hearing protection. This gear protects against flying debris, dust inhalation, and excessive noise, which can cause serious injuries or long-term health issues.
- Proper Tool Inspection: Before using an angle grinder, inspect the tool for any damages, such as frayed cords or worn-out wheels. A thorough inspection ensures that the equipment functions correctly and reduces the risk of malfunctions that could lead to accidents.
- Correct Wheel Selection: Use the appropriate grinding or cutting wheel for woodworking tasks. Different materials require specific wheels, and using the wrong type can lead to excessive wear, poor performance, or even breakage, which can cause injuries.
- Stable Work Surface: Secure the workpiece on a stable surface to prevent it from moving while grinding. A properly secured workpiece allows for more control and reduces the chances of sudden movements that could lead to accidents.
- Two-Handed Operation: Always operate the angle grinder with both hands on the tool for better control. This practice helps maintain stability and minimizes the risk of losing control, which can lead to injuries.
- Clear Work Area: Keep the work area free from clutter and distractions. A clean and organized workspace reduces the risk of tripping or bumping into objects that could cause accidents while operating the angle grinder.
- Follow Manufacturer Instructions: Adhere to the manufacturer’s guidelines for safe operation and maintenance of the angle grinder. Understanding the specific features and limitations of the tool ensures that it is used correctly and safely.
- Awareness of Surroundings: Be mindful of the surroundings and any potential hazards, such as flammable materials or other people in the vicinity. Maintaining awareness helps prevent accidents and ensures a safe working environment.
What Common Woodworking Tasks Can Be Accomplished with an Angle Grinder?
An angle grinder can be an incredibly versatile tool in woodworking, allowing for a variety of tasks to be accomplished effectively.
- Cutting: Angle grinders excel at cutting through various materials, including wood, metal, and plastic. With the right blade, they can make quick work of lumber or plywood, allowing for precise cuts that are essential in woodworking projects.
- Sanding: By attaching a sanding disc, angle grinders can be used for smoothing surfaces and removing paint or varnish. This capability can save time compared to traditional sanding methods and allows for a more uniform finish on wooden surfaces.
- Sharpening Tools: Angle grinders can also be used to sharpen woodworking tools such as chisels and blades. Using a grinding wheel attachment, woodworkers can maintain the sharpness of their tools, ensuring cleaner cuts and more efficient work.
- Polishing: When fitted with a polishing pad, an angle grinder can help achieve a glossy finish on wooden items. This is particularly useful for finishing projects where a high-quality appearance is desired, making the wood look more appealing.
- Removing Material: Angle grinders can quickly remove excess material or imperfections from wood surfaces. This is particularly beneficial when reshaping or refinishing wood, as it allows for rapid adjustments to be made.
- Carving: With specialized carving discs, angle grinders can be used for detailed wood carving. This allows woodworkers to create intricate designs and patterns, adding a unique touch to their projects.
